Limited Time Offer – Book Your Complementary Consultation

Why Is My Website Not Showing on Google in Michigan? 7 Proven Fixes for 2026

Is your Michigan business website invisible in Google search results, even when customers search for your exact services? This frustrating issue affects over 70% of small business websites nationwide, and Michigan companies in competitive areas like Detroit, Grand Rapids, Ann Arbor, and Lansing face it even more acutely due to fierce local competition. The good news? Most causes are fixable with targeted action.

EchoWings Media, your premier Michigan SEO agency, has helped hundreds of local businesses—from Wayne County retailers to Kent County service providers—reclaim their Google visibility through proven strategies. This in-depth guide explores the five most common reasons your site isn’t showing up: indexing failures, missing backlinks, poor keyword targeting, thin content, and slow loading speeds.

We’ll break down each problem behind “why is my website not showing on Google” using real-world Michigan examples, step-by-step fixes, data-backed insights, and case studies. You’ll see direct ties to EchoWings Media services like technical SEO audits, local keyword research, content optimization, and site speed enhancements. By the end, you’ll have a clear, actionable roadmap to higher rankings, plus FAQs, schema recommendations, and a strong call-to-action. Let’s dive in and get your site found.

find out why is my website not showing on Google

Common Reason 1: Your Site Isn’t Indexed by Google

The most fundamental issue: Google simply doesn’t know your website exists. Without indexing, no amount of great content or design will help your pages appear in search results. This problem plagues about 40% of newly launched Michigan business sites, particularly those built on WordPress without proper setup.

What Exactly Causes Indexing Problems?

Google relies on web crawlers (Googlebot) to discover and index pages. Common blockers include:

  • Missing or broken sitemap.xml: Without this roadmap file, Googlebot can’t efficiently find your pages.
  • Robots.txt errors: Accidental blocks like “Disallow: /” hide your entire site.
  • JavaScript-heavy sites: Modern single-page apps (SPAs) often render poorly for crawlers.
  • Noindex tags or meta directives: These explicitly tell Google to ignore pages.
  • Server issues: 5xx errors or slow responses prevent crawling.

In Michigan, where 46% of all Google searches have local intent (e.g., “Detroit plumber near me” or “Grand Rapids web design“), unindexed sites miss massive opportunities. E-commerce stores in Oakland County launching without sitemaps often stay invisible for months.

Duplicate content from template-based builders also triggers deindexing—Google filters out low-value copies. Thin service pages copied from competitors fare worst.

Step-by-Step Fix for Indexing Issues

  1. Verify the problem: Search “site:yourdomain.com” in Google to check indexed pages. If no results appear, your website is not indexed, signaling technical or submission issues.
  2. Set up Google Search Console (GSC): Create a free Google Search Console account to monitor indexing status, crawl errors, and performance data. Submit your sitemap.xml for faster discovery.
  3. Create and submit sitemap: Generate an XML sitemap using plugins like Yoast for WordPress or tools such as XML-Sitemaps.com, then submit it in Google Search Console.
  4. Request indexing: Use the URL Inspection tool inside Google Search Console to manually request indexing for important pages. Priority requests typically process within one to seven days.
  5. Audit robots.txt and meta tags: Check your robots.txt file and page meta tags for accidental noindex or disallow directives. Use Google Search Console’s testing tools to confirm.
  6. Link to Google Business Profile: Connect your website to your Google Business Profile to strengthen local signals. Michigan businesses often experience significantly faster local indexing and visibility improvements.

EchoWings Media’s comprehensive technical SEO audit identifies these issues in under 48 hours, including custom sitemap creation and GSC setup. We’ve indexed 200+ Michigan sites, boosting initial visibility by 300% on average. For Wayne County clients, we add local schema markup to accelerate the process.

Common Reason 2: Lack of Quality Backlinks

Even indexed sites struggle without backlinks—the “votes” Google uses to gauge authority. Michigan competitors with established link profiles from local directories and news sites dominate rankings.

Why Backlinks Remain Crucial in 2026

Google’s algorithms (including post-2025 Helpful Content Updates) prioritize domain authority. High-quality backlinks from relevant sources signal trustworthiness. For local “near me” searches—which account for 88% of mobile queries in Michigan—links from PureMichigan.com, Yelp, or Angi carry extra weight.

Without them, your site lacks the “link equity” to compete. Spammy links from PBNs (private blog networks) backfire with penalties, but quality ones from local chambers or guest posts deliver lasting gains.

Proven Backlink Building Strategies for Michigan Businesses

  • Local directories: Claim profiles on Michigan.org, Yelp, Angi, YellowPages, and city-specific sites (e.g., Detroit Regional Chamber).
  • Guest posting: Contribute to authority blogs like Detroit News, Grand Rapids Business Journal, or MLive.
  • Partnerships: Collaborate with complementary businesses for co-branded content (e.g., a Lansing web designer linking with local marketers).
  • Resource pages: Get featured on “best Michigan SEO resources” lists.
  • HARO (Help a Reporter Out): Respond to journalist queries for media mentions.

Target 10-20 quality links monthly with DA 40+. EchoWings Media’s link-building service secures DA 50+ placements, elevating Oakland County clients’ authority by 200% and landing them in Google’s local 3-pack.

Common Reason 3: Poor Keyword Targeting and On-Page SEO

Your pages might be indexed with backlinks, but if they don’t match user search intent, Google won’t show them. Keyword gaps are rampant among Michigan small businesses.

Identifying Keyword Problems

For example, the keyword “why is my website not showing on Google” signals problem-aware users. Michigan variations explode potential:

  • Long-tail: “fix website not indexed Detroit,” “SEO audit Grand Rapids near me.”
  • Local intent: “website not ranking Lansing small business.”
  • Semantic LSI: “Google indexing issues Michigan,” “GSC errors fix,” “site not crawled.”

Top competitors underuse these; generic pages rank poorly.

Optimization Roadmap

  1. Research: Use Google Keyword Planner to identify keywords with 1,000+ monthly searches and strong commercial intent. Analyze competition levels, seasonal trends, and related keyword variations. Prioritize terms that balance search volume and ranking feasibility, ensuring they align with your services and local audience demand.
  2. On-Page Placement: Place your primary keyword naturally in the H1 tag, within the first 100 words of the introduction, and maintain a 1–2% keyword density. Include variations in subheadings (H2, H3) and throughout the content to strengthen topical relevance without over-optimization.
  3. Local Modifiers: Incorporate geo-specific terms like “Detroit,” “Grand Rapids,” “Wayne County,” and “Michigan near me” to capture high-intent local searches. These modifiers help search engines connect your services with regional queries, improving visibility in both organic results and map listings.
  4. Internal Linking: Strategically link blog posts and informational pages to relevant service pages using descriptive anchor text. Internal linking distributes authority, improves crawlability, increases user engagement, and guides visitors toward conversion-focused pages, strengthening both SEO performance and lead generation.

EchoWings Media’s keyword research uncovers 50+ terms per page, surging Ann Arbor traffic by 150%. Here’s a comparison table:

Keyword TypeMichigan ExampleMonthly Vol.Competition
Primarywhy website not showing Google1,200Medium
Long-Tailfix site not indexed Lansing300Low
Near MeSEO help near me Flint500Medium
SemanticGSC errors Grand Rapids200Low
Questionhow to get site on Google MI400Low

Common Reason 4: Thin or Low-Quality Content

Google deprioritizes “thin affiliate-style” content under 1,000 words that lacks depth, context, and original insight—often a core reason behind why is my website not showing on Google. Michigan service pages averaging just 250 words rank nearly 40% lower than comprehensive 2,000+ word guides that demonstrate expertise, authority, and real value.

Hallmarks of Thin Content

  • Surface-level info without examples or stats.
  • No E-E-A-T (Experience, Expertise, Authoritativeness, Trustworthiness).
  • Missing visuals, FAQs, or user-focused value.

Building Ranking Content

  • Aim for 1,500-3,000 words with case studies (e.g., “Lansing retailer +300% traffic”).
  • Use bullets, tables, subheads for dwell time.
  • Incorporate Michigan relevance: “Wayne County businesses lose $X from poor content.”

EchoWings crafts pillar content filling gaps like “local SEO Michigan,” linking to service pages.

Common Reason 5: Slow Site Speed and Core Web Vitals

53% of users abandon sites loading over 3 seconds—critical for mobile Michigan searches. Core Web Vitals (LCP, FID, CLS) are direct ranking factors.

Diagnosing Issues

  • Test: PageSpeed Insights (aim 90+).
  • Culprits: Unoptimized images (70% of sites), no CDN, heavy plugins.

Fixes

  • Compress images; enable lazy loading.
  • Minify CSS/JS; use fast Michigan hosting.
  • Implement caching.

EchoWings reduces load times 70% for Grand Rapids e-commerce, preventing $2.6B annual lost sales.

Case Study: Wayne County Retailer Turnaround

A Detroit retailer launched but vanished from Google.

  • Issues: No sitemap, thin pages, duplicates.
  • EchoWings Solution: XML submission, 1,800-word rewrites, 15 local links.
  • Results: Indexed in 72 hours, 400% traffic, top 3 rankings.

Mobile Optimization Deep Dive

60% Michigan searches are mobile. Fail responsive design? Buried.

  • Viewport tags, thumb nav, AMP.
  • Audits fix 70% issues; bounces drop 45%.
MetricTargetImpact
LCP<2.5sConversions
FID<100msAbandons
CLS<0.1UX

Duplicate Content Fixes

30% sites penalized. Use canonical tags; create unique local pages.

GBP and Local Signals

Unclaimed profiles miss map packs. Add photos, posts; sync NAP.

E-E-A-T Boosters

Author bios, testimonials, stats build authority.

FAQ

Q. How to index quickly?

A. GSC sitemap submission works best. Add schema for Michigan speed.

Q. Indexed but not ranking?

A. Keywords/speed gaps hurt visibility. Audit needed for fixes.

Q. Site speed impact 2026?

A. Core Web Vitals affect 40% rankings. Mobile crucial in MI.

Q. Michigan backlinks?

A. Local directories/chambers build authority. Aim DA 40+ links.

Q. Thin content fix?

A. 1,500+ words via EchoWings boosts depth. Add local examples.

Q. First step?

A. GSC check reveals issues fast. Start indexing today.

Q. EchoWings for Grand Rapids?

A. Free Michigan audit available. Kent County specialists ready.

Get Visible Now

Contact EchoWings Media for your free Michigan SEO audit and finally solve why is my website not showing on Google. Dominate Detroit and Grand Rapids searches with expert technical fixes, local optimization, and proven ranking strategies—visit echowingsmedia.com/contact today.